Best Pavilion Designs from Shanghai World Expo 2010

Shanghai World Expo 2010 is a tremendous social event that has gathered over 190 countries and over 50 international organizations. Over 100 pavilions have been created and all of them are real masterpieces. This is an unforgettable mix of cultures, styles and world views. We’ve chosen what we think are the most notable pavilion designs and today we are glad to presenting this small collection to you.
